This farm practice was, conducted at Don Severino Agricultural College Piggery Project, from September 1, 1987 to January 7, 1988. A loan of P 3,997.30 from DSAC Extension Services was used 9, Four months feeding trial was made and it helped attain an average final weight of 180 kilograms with feed efficiency of 3.64 kilogram’s. It was noted that 5% RBD1 or rice bran "cono" could be incorporated in a feed mixture without any bad effect on the growth of hogs.
